Surfer SEO: Your All-in-One Content Optimisation Partner

Creating content that ranks well on Google can feel like solving a puzzle, but Surfer SEO simplifies this process with its comprehensive analysis capabilities. This tool scans over 500 on-page signals in a single sweep, giving you a detailed breakdown of what your content needs to succeed. Surfer SEO doesn’t just provide data; it integrates seamlessly with platforms like Jasper to offer real-time optimisation while you write.

What makes Surfer stand out is its ability to generate tailored content briefs that outline exactly what your content should include to rank highly. Whether you’re a small business or a large enterprise, Surfer’s pricing plans, starting at £89 per month, make it accessible. For marketers looking to take the guesswork out of on-page SEO, this tool is a game-changer.

Frase: Streamlining Content Creation with AI

When it comes to crafting engaging, search-friendly content, Frase is a marketer’s best friend. It doesn’t just suggest keywords—it generates detailed content briefs and even recommends questions to answer in your articles, ensuring your content resonates with your audience. Frase’s predictive insights also provide a glimpse into how well your content is likely to perform, saving you time and effort.

Starting at just £15 per month, Frase is perfect for individual users and small teams aiming to optimise their content strategy without breaking the bank. By simplifying the content creation process and offering actionable insights, Frase empowers marketers to produce content that not only ranks but also engages readers.

Alli AI: Making Technical SEO Accessible

Technical SEO can be intimidating, especially for those without coding expertise. Enter Alli AI, a tool designed to make on-page optimisation more approachable. With its user-friendly interface, Alli AI enables bulk optimisations and automated A/B testing across various content management systems. Features like real-time updates, automated schema markups, and internal linking are all included, making it ideal for agencies and enterprises.

Although its starting price of £299 per month might be a stretch for smaller businesses, the time-saving capabilities it offers are invaluable for larger teams looking to scale their SEO efforts. Alli AI removes the technical barriers, allowing marketers to focus on strategy rather than code.

Brand24: Monitoring Your Brand’s Online Reputation

While not an SEO tool in the traditional sense, Brand24 plays a pivotal role in boosting SEO strategies by monitoring brand mentions and online sentiment. By tracking what people are saying about your brand across social media and web platforms, Brand24 provides insights that can inform your content and outreach strategies. Sentiment analysis allows businesses to understand public perception, making it easier to tailor content that aligns with audience expectations.

With pricing starting at £49 per month, Brand24 is a cost-effective way to integrate social listening into your SEO strategy. By leveraging these insights, businesses can create more targeted and effective campaigns, ultimately improving their search rankings.

SNOV.IO: Simplifying Link-Building Strategies

Link-building is a cornerstone of any successful SEO strategy, but it’s often time-consuming. SNOV.IO streamlines this process by automating outreach efforts. Its email finder and verifier make it easy to connect with potential link partners, while its drip campaign feature ensures consistent follow-ups without additional effort. These capabilities not only save time but also improve the success rate of link-building campaigns.

Starting at £39 per month, SNOV.IO is an affordable solution for businesses looking to enhance their website’s authority and visibility. By simplifying the outreach process, SNOV.IO helps marketers focus on building meaningful connections that drive results.

Extra Tool: Clearscope for Optimising Existing Content

Sometimes, the key to better rankings isn’t new content but improving what you already have. Clearscope excels in this area by offering keyword suggestions based on top-performing content in your niche. Its detailed reports provide actionable recommendations for enhancing your content’s relevance and quality.

While Clearscope’s pricing starts at £170 per month, its focus on refining existing content can deliver a significant return on investment. For businesses aiming to maintain relevance in an ever-changing SEO landscape, Clearscope is a must-have.
